Boston (dbTechno) – A new class of breast cancer drugs are showing an amazing level of promise in their ability to treat the terrible disease.
This new class of breast cancer drugs is known as PARP inhibitors, and have shown the amazing ability to actually combat hard-to-defeat breast cancer tumors.
These same tumors have shown a high level of resistance to more common treatment techniques.
There are a few different companies working on this new class of drugs, one such being a drug from Sanofi Aventis.
Studies have shown that these new drugs can help extend the survival rate of women with breast cancer.
In a study on the Sanofi Aventis drug, the median survival rate was extended in over 100 women studies. The survival rate of these women with severe breast cancer tumors increased from 5.7 months up to 9.2 months.
These drugs have shown the ability to shrink tumors in the majority of patients treated, at far higher success rates than chemotherapy.
